REGIONAL INTERGOVERNMENTAL UPDATES Mayor and Council updates: Councilmember Schroeder announced the recent Central Arizona Government(CAG) meeting he attended. He stated they passed the budget and announced there is$15 million for State Route 24 expansion and$15 million for the North South corridor assessment. The Pinal County road tax will be on the fall ballot as Proposition 469. CAG also just completed a 2018 audit which was very positive. PUBLIC HEARINGS 8. 22-367 Presentation, discussion and public hearing on Resolution 22-02, declaring as a public record that certain document filed with the city clerk entitled"2022 Apache Junction City Code, Vol. 11, Land Development Code, Chapter 7: Development Fees." Planner Kelsey Schattnik provided an update on item 22-367 and 22-369; changes to the Apache Junction City Code Vol. II Land Development Code, Chapter 7: Development Fees. The process started several months ago and the city contracted with TischlerBise to document land use assumptions, prepare the Infrastructure Improvements Plan (hereinafter referred to as the "IIP"), and update development fees pursuant to Arizona Revised Statutes("ARS") § 9-436.05 (hereafter referred to as the"Enabling Legislation"). Municipalities in Arizona may assess development fees to offset infrastructure costs to a municipality for necessary public services. The development fees must be based on an Infrastructure Improvements Plan and Land Use Assumptions. The proposed development fees are displayed in the Development Fee Report. Development fees are one-time payments used to construct system improvements needed to accommodate new development.The fee represents future development's proportionate share of infrastructure costs. Development fees may be used for infrastructure improvements or debt service for growth related infrastructure. In contrast to general taxes, development fees may not be used for operations, maintenance, replacement, or correcting existing deficiencies.This update of Apache Junction's Infrastructure Improvements Plan and associated update to its development fees includes the following necessary public services: 1. Library Facilities 2. Parks and Recreational Facilities 3. Police Facilities 4. Street Facilities This plan includes all necessary elements required to be in full compliance with SB 1525. NEW BUSINESS 10. 22-386 Presentation and discussion on the Public Works' Fiscal Year 2022-2023 Capital Improvement and Street Maintenance Plan. Public Works Manager Shane Kiesow and Public Works Director Mike Wever presented the 2023 Street Capital Improvement Maintenance Plan. The plan provided an updated 2022 street inventory, remaining service life of the various streets, capital maintenance projects and new capital construction, along with other projects such as curb installations, sidewalks, storm drain extensions and time frames for those projects. This item will be on the July 19, 2022, council agenda for consideration. 11. 22-387 Presentation and discussion of agreement with Roadway Electric, LLC for traffic signal repair services through the City of Mesa Cooperative Contract #2022146,for one(1)year in an amount not to exceed$400,000.00 with an option to renew annually and not to exceed five (5) years. Public Works Manager Shane Kiesow and Public Works Director Mike Wever presented information on the Roadway Electric agreement for material and services for emergency/unplanned repairs of the city's traffic signals and street lighting.This agreement utilizes the Mesa's cooperative contract number 2022146 and is for one year with an optional one(1)year renewal, not to exceed a total of five(5)years.The maximum annual amount over the life of this agreement is not to exceed$400,000 with no minimum, or maximum number of purchases guaranteed being made by the city.
